History of Château de Goulaine

Nestled in the picturesque Loire Valley, Château de Goulaine boasts a rich history dating back to the 12th century. Originally constructed as a medieval fortress, it has witnessed countless transformations over the centuries. The Goulaine family, who have owned the château for over a thousand years, played a significant role in the region's history, including influential positions in French nobility and politics.

In the 15th century, the castle was renovated into a Renaissance-style château, blending medieval fortifications with elegant architectural elements. The Goulaine estate also became renowned for its exceptional vineyards, producing fine Muscadet wines that are still celebrated today.

During the 18th century, Château de Goulaine further embraced its role as a cultural hub, hosting literary salons and artistic gatherings. Today, visitors can explore the château's lavish interiors, filled with antique furnishings, period art, and historical artifacts. The estate also features the Marquise de Goulaine's Butterfly Museum, showcasing an extensive collection of exotic butterflies.

Unique features of Château de Goulaine

One of the most unique features of Château de Goulaine is its butterfly greenhouse, which houses an impressive collection of exotic species from around the world. This vibrant display of fluttering colors offers a serene and enchanting experience for visitors.

Another distinctive aspect is the museum dedicated to the French biscuit brand, LU (Lefèvre-Utile). The museum showcases an extensive collection of memorabilia, packaging, and advertisements, providing a nostalgic journey through the history of one of France's most beloved biscuit brands.

The château itself boasts a striking blend of Renaissance and medieval architecture, with ornate stone carvings and elegant interiors that reflect the opulent lifestyle of its former inhabitants. The property also includes beautifully manicured gardens and a vineyard, offering visitors a chance to taste the local Muscadet wine, which has been produced on the estate for centuries.

Additionally, Château de Goulaine is famous for its rare and ancient kitchen, featuring original 16th-century equipment and utensils. This well-preserved kitchen provides a fascinating glimpse into the culinary practices of the past, making it a standout feature among French châteaux.

How to get to Château de Goulaine

Château de Goulaine is conveniently accessible by various transportation options in Nantes, France. If you're flying in, Nantes Atlantique Airport is approximately 10.2 miles (16.4 km) away from Nantes. From there, you can easily reach Château de Goulaine by taxi or shuttle.

For those already in Nantes, buses, taxis, and walking are viable options to reach Château de Goulaine, which is located 7.2 miles (11.5 km) from the city center. You can also rent a car and drive to Château de Goulaine, providing flexibility to explore at your leisure. Its exact address is All. Du Château, 44115 Haute-Goulaine, France.
